Server Redundancy: Importance, Types, and Best Practices
In today’s digital landscape, businesses and organizations rely heavily on servers to store, process, and manage data. Any server downtime can lead to significant financial losses, data breaches, and operational inefficiencies. This is where server redundancy plays a critical role in ensuring business continuity and minimizing the risk of data loss.
What Is Server Redundancy?
Server redundancy refers to the practice of deploying multiple servers to ensure continuous availability and reliability. It involves having backup systems that can take over when a primary server fails, thus reducing downtime and maintaining seamless operations. Redundant servers are crucial for data centers, cloud computing, and enterprise IT environments.
Why Is It Important?
- Minimizes Downtime – With a backup system, businesses can maintain uninterrupted services even if one server fails.
- Ensures Data Protection – Redundancy helps protect sensitive business data from being lost due to hardware failure or cyber threats.
- Enhanced Performance – Load balancing across redundant servers improves performance and prevents bottlenecks.
- Strengthens Disaster Recovery – Having redundant systems accelerates disaster recovery, ensuring quick restoration of services after unexpected failures.
- Improves Customer Experience – Continuous uptime enhances user satisfaction and trust, leading to better business outcomes.
Types of Server Redundancy
- Hardware Redundancy – This involves having duplicate hardware components, such as power supplies, network cards, and hard drives, to prevent failures caused by hardware malfunctions.
- Network Redundancy – Multiple network connections, routers, and switches ensure seamless data transfer even if a network component fails.
- Data Redundancy – Data is stored in multiple locations, including backup servers, cloud storage, or RAID (Redundant Array of Independent Disks) systems, to prevent data loss.
- Geographic Redundancy – Data and services are distributed across multiple locations to safeguard against natural disasters, regional outages, and cyber-attacks.
- Cloud Redundancy – Cloud-based redundancy solutions ensure data is replicated across multiple cloud servers, improving availability and scalability.
Best Practices for Implementing Server Redundancy
- Assess Business Needs – Identify critical applications and services that require redundancy.
- Deploy Load Balancing – Distribute traffic across multiple servers to enhance performance and prevent failures.
- Use RAID Configurations – Implement RAID storage solutions for efficient data redundancy.
- Regularly Monitor and Test Systems – Conduct routine checks and failover tests to ensure redundancy mechanisms function correctly.
- Implement Disaster Recovery Plans – Establish a well-documented disaster recovery strategy to quickly restore services.
- Leverage Cloud Solutions – Utilize cloud-based redundancy to ensure high availability and scalability.
- Update and Maintain Infrastructure – Regular software and hardware updates help prevent vulnerabilities and improve reliability.
Conclusion
Server redundancy is a crucial aspect of modern IT infrastructure, ensuring high availability, security, and operational efficiency. Businesses should invest in robust redundancy strategies to safeguard against unexpected failures and provide seamless services to users. By implementing best practices and leveraging advanced redundancy technologies, organizations can enhance their resilience and maintain business continuity in the face of challenges.